石斛药用次生代谢产物及其基因克隆研究进展  被引量:19

Advances in medicinal secondary metabolites and gene cloning of Dendrobium officinale

摘  要:石斛是我国名贵药用植物之一,其主要药用成分是其次生代谢物,但其来源有限、含量低、成本高,限制石斛使用空间。研究石斛药用成分的次生代谢产物的网络结构、限速步骤,解析次生代谢合成过程,掌握其药用成分的产生规律,并进行基因克隆或仿生物合成等,对合理开发利用石斛资源有重要意义。文章对石斛的次生代谢产物包括代谢物的检测和鉴定、代谢关键酶的识别和克隆等多方的研究取得的进展作简要综述。Dendrobium is one of the precious medicinal plants in China.Its main medicinal component is its secondary metabolite.However,its source is limited,its content is low,and its cost is high.The price of Dendrobium is especially expensive, which limits the space for Dendrobium to seek human welfare.It is important to study the network structure and speed-limiting steps of the secondary metabolites of Dendrobium officinale components,analyze the process of secondary metabolic synthesis, master the production regularity of its medicinal components,and carry out gene cloning or biomimetic synthesis for the rational development and utilization of Dendrobium resources.This paper reviews the progress in the research of secondary metabolites of Dendrobium,including the detection and identification of metabolites,the identification and cloning of key metabolic enzymes.
